In private conversations, the president doesn’t hold back. He has referred to Trump as a “sick f*ck” when speaking to long-time friends and close aides, a description confirmed by three individuals who have heard him use this explicit term.

One person familiar with the discussions quoted Biden’s recent remark about Trump: “What a f*cking *sshole the guy is” according to a Politico report.

Biden, known for his use of colorful language in private settings, went public during an address at Valley Forge to commemorate the third anniversary of the January 6th Capitol breach. With visible frustration and anger, he criticized Trump and his supporters for their apparent enjoyment of political unrest.

“In his gathering, he made light of an assailant, motivated by the Big Trump Lie, attacking Paul Pelosi with a hammer,” Biden remarked. “And he finds amusement in that,” the president added. “He chuckled over it. What a sick…” Biden paused.

The Trump campaign criticized Biden for his comments. “It’s a shame that Crooked Joe Biden disrespects the presidency both publicly and privately,” stated Chris Lacivita, a senior adviser for the Trump campaign. “But then again, it’s no surprise he disrespects the 45th president the same way he disrespects the American people with his failed policies.”

When queried by Fox News Digital for a response, a White House representative resorted to calling the media’s focus on the president’s use of strong language “snowflake.”

There have been previous accounts indicating that Biden tends to raise his voice at White House aides in private and summon them for “angry interrogations.” These accounts claim that Biden possesses a “quick-trigger temper,” leading to attempts by some staff members to avoid one-on-one encounters with him.

“To mitigate the impact of a direct confrontation, some staff members prefer to bring along a colleague, serving almost as a protective barrier,” said aides of Biden last summer.

An Axios report from July detailed President Biden’s public persona as a whispering, avuncular figure contrasts sharply with private accounts of him having a quick-trigger temper, leading to some aides avoiding meetings alone with him due to fears of being on the receiving end of his intense outbursts.
